Address

LLSKESUEMUqSiLae895N5k2DPXCyuqPWciCopy

Total Received

1240.48272143 LTC

Total Sent

393.6483535 LTC

№ Transactions

235

Final Balance

846.83436793 LTC

Transactions
Filter